How TruSeen™ Tracks Heart Rate:

Heart-rate monitoring is the backbone of all wearable health technology. TruSeen™ uses photoplethysmography (PPG) — a big word for a simple concept.

Here’s the easy explanation:

  1. The watch shines a light (usually green LEDs) into your skin.
  2. Your blood absorbs some of that light.
  3. Sensors detect how much light is reflected back.
  4. Your pulse changes this reflection pattern.
  5. The watch converts it into heart-rate data.

The latest TruSeen™ versions use:

  • multiple LEDs
  • multiple photodiodes
  • deeper light penetration
  • anti-interference algorithms
  • skin-contact detection

How TruSeen™ Tracks SpO₂:

Blood oxygen (SpO₂) indicates how well your blood carries oxygen throughout your body.
Low oxygen levels can indicate fatigue, altitude stress, or respiratory issues.

TruSeen™ uses a red + infrared light sensor to detect:

  • how much oxygen your red blood cells carry
  • how your breathing patterns change
  • your overnight oxygen saturation

It shows:

  • 95–100% → normal
  • 90–94% → low
  • below 90% → concerning (seek medical help)

Smartwatches are not medical devices, but they give early warnings that help users act responsibly.

How TruSeen™ Measures Stress Levels:

Stress tracking might seem complicated, but it’s actually simple.

Also Read:  Fire‑Boltt Ring X Features: BT Calling, Battery, Display and Price

Stress levels rise when:

  • heart-rate variability decreases
  • tension increases
  • breathing becomes shallow
  • rest periods reduce

TruSeen™ measures HRV (Heart Rate Variability) — the time gap between your heartbeats.

  • High HRV → relaxed, calm
  • Low HRV → stressed, anxious

The watch uses this to generate a stress score (0–100).

How Accurate Is TruSeen™?

Smartwatch sensors, including TruSeen™, are not medical-grade, but they are generally reliable for:

  • trends
  • patterns
  • everyday health tracking
  • workout intensity
  • sleep behaviour

Accuracy is usually affected by:

  • loose straps
  • tattoos
  • excessive movement
  • cold skin
  • very dark skin tones
  • strong arm hair

But modern TruSeen™ versions use AI to reduce these errors.

In real-world use, it is considered one of the most consistent continuous monitoring systems on non-medical wearables.

How Smartwatches Read Your Movements:

Most body language cues come from movement, and smartwatches use two main sensors to track it:
Accelerometer – Measures how quickly your wrist moves
Gyroscope – Detects rotation and orientation
Together, these sensors can interpret actions such as:
• Are you walking energetically or slowly?
• Are your gestures rapid, calm, shaky, or tense?
• Are you sitting, running, or fidgeting?
• Are you lifting weights or typing on a keyboard?
These tiny motions reveal a surprising amount of your emotional and physical state. For example:
• Rapid, restless hand movements may indicate stress or anxiety
• Smooth, fluid movement may indicate relaxed confidence
• Slow, heavy motion may suggest fatigue
This isn’t guesswork—companies like Apple, Fitbit, and Garmin use machine-learning models trained on millions of movement samples to analyze these details.

How Smartwatches Interpret Your Emotional State?

Your emotions influence your body, and smartwatches track these changes through several biometrics:
Heart rate – increases with stress or excitement
Heart-rate variability (HRV) – lower HRV often means tension or fatigue (Harvard Health supports this correlation)
Skin temperature – rises or falls with stress, sleep cycles, or hormonal shifts
Blood oxygen levels – linked to breathing and physical strain
When the sensors notice irregularities—such as a sudden heart-rate spike while you’re sitting—they interpret it as “stress activation.” This is why your watch may prompt you with notifications like “Take a moment to breathe” even before you realize you’re stressed. It understands the body’s subtle signs before your mind catches up.
